Softball Preview: Licking Wildcats vs. Salem Tigers
The Licking Wildcats will square off against the Salem Tigers at 6:00 p.m. on Monday. The two teams are sauntering into the matchup backed by comfortable wins in their prior games.
If Licking beats Salem with 11 runs on Monday, it's going to be the team's new lucky number: they've won their past two games with that exact score. The Wildcats beat Steelville on Friday by the very same score they won with in their prior game: 11-1. The result was nothing new for the Wildcats, who have now won 11 matchups by seven runs or more so far this season.
Meanwhile, it was a proper cat-fight when Salem challenged Kingston on Friday. The Tigers were the clear victors by a 16-1 margin over the Cougars. The high-scoring performance was a welcome turnaround for the Tigers' hitters, who had struggled in the games prior.
Licking pushed their record up to 14-9 with the victory, which was their third straight at home. The home wins came thanks in part to their pitching effort, having only surrendered 4.0 runs on average over those games. As for Salem, their victory bumped their record up to 13-11.
Licking came up short against Salem when the teams last played back in April, falling 15-10. Can the Wildcats av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
